Custom Retail Software Development: Unlock Your Competitive Edge Today

In today’s fast-paced retail world, standing out is tougher than finding a needle in a haystack—especially when that haystack is filled with cookie-cutter software solutions. Custom retail software development isn’t just a luxury; it’s the secret sauce that can turn a good business into a great one. With tailored solutions, retailers can streamline operations, enhance customer experiences, and boost sales faster than you can say “checkout line.”

Imagine a world where your software fits your business like a glove, handling everything from inventory management to customer loyalty programs. Custom solutions offer flexibility and scalability, ensuring your retail operation can adapt to trends faster than a customer can swipe their credit card. So, if you’re ready to ditch the one-size-fits-all approach, let’s dive into the world of custom retail software development and discover how it can elevate your business to new heights.

Overview of Custom Retail Software Development

Custom retail software development focuses on creating solutions specifically designed to meet the unique needs of retailers. This approach enables businesses to address specific challenges and objectives, improving overall efficiency and customer satisfaction. Tailored software solutions offer flexibility that off-the-shelf products can’t provide, allowing businesses to adapt swiftly to ever-changing market demands.

Many retailers experience limitations with generic software. Challenges include insufficient functionality, lack of scalability, and difficulty in integration with existing systems. Custom software development mitigates these issues by designing applications that seamlessly integrate into current workflows, enhancing operational processes.

Cost considerations also play a role in the decision for custom solutions. Though initial investments may be higher, long-term savings are achievable through improved operational efficiency and reduced downtime. Custom applications often lead to better inventory management, streamlined sales processes, and improved customer engagement strategies.

In addition, custom solutions enhance data analytics capabilities, providing valuable insights into consumer behavior and market trends. By leveraging this data, retailers can make informed decisions that drive growth. Optimized software enhances the customer experience, leading to increased loyalty and higher sales.

Competitive advantage stems from the ability to innovate and respond quickly to market changes. Custom retail software development positions retailers to not only keep pace with trends but to set them. Businesses can uniquely tailor their offerings and enhance their brand identity, fostering stronger connections with their customers.

Benefits of Custom Retail Software

Custom retail software offers numerous advantages that can significantly enhance a retailer’s performance. By focusing on tailored solutions, businesses meet their specific needs, which enhances overall efficiency.

Tailored Solutions for Unique Needs

Custom retail software creates solutions designed for specific operational requirements. Retailers gain flexibility to address particular challenges that generic software cannot resolve. Such personalization allows businesses to integrate unique features that align with their brand strategies. Moreover, the development process involves key stakeholders, ensuring the final product meets everyone’s expectations. As a result, retailers experience increased customer satisfaction and improved brand loyalty, which positively impacts overall performance.

Improved Efficiency and Productivity

Improved efficiency and productivity stem from customized software solutions that streamline processes. Automation of routine tasks reduces manual errors and saves valuable time. Real-time data updates enhance decision-making, allowing retailers to respond quickly to market trends. Productivity sees a boost when staff can focus on more critical aspects of their jobs rather than mundane tasks. Furthermore, integration of custom software into existing systems helps ensure seamless workflows, enhancing collaboration among team members. Consequently, retailers achieve higher operational efficiency, leading to increased profitability.

Key Features to Consider

Custom retail software development offers several essential features that directly impact operational success. Focusing on these key areas can lead to significant improvements in efficiency and customer satisfaction.

Inventory Management

Efficient inventory management stands as a cornerstone of retail success. Custom solutions enable real-time tracking of stock levels, reducing the risk of overstocking or stockouts. Retailers can also automate reorder processes based on sales data, ensuring optimum inventory levels. Enhanced analytics within these systems provide insights into product performance, enabling informed decisions about product offerings. Additionally, integration with point-of-sale systems allows for seamless updates to inventory counts, streamlining operations. Companies benefit from tailored reporting features that highlight trends specific to their businesses.

Customer Relationship Management

Effective customer relationship management is vital for fostering loyalty. Custom software enables personalized communication and engagement strategies tailored to individual customer preferences. Retailers can leverage comprehensive customer data to create targeted marketing campaigns, enhancing the shopping experience. Features like behavior tracking assist in identifying patterns that facilitate timely engagement with customers. Integration with feedback systems allows businesses to gather insights directly from consumers, driving continuous improvement. Furthermore, tailored solutions can incorporate loyalty or reward programs, motivating repeat purchases and strengthening brand loyalty.

The Development Process

The development process of custom retail software involves several key stages crucial for creating effective solutions.

Requirement Gathering

Requirement gathering starts with understanding the retailer’s specific needs. Stakeholders discuss their objectives, challenges, and desired features. This dialogue leads to a clear outline of functional and non-functional requirements. Detailed documentation captures insights, ensuring accountability throughout the process. Conducting interviews and surveys with end-users often unveils additional insights, directly informing the development team. Prioritizing requirements helps identify essential features that align with business goals.

Design and Prototyping

In the design and prototyping phase, visual layouts and interactions come to life. User experience designers create wireframes and mockups that represent the software’s look and feel. Engaging stakeholders in this stage secures feedback crucial for refinement before development begins. Iterative design processes allow for adjustments based on real user input. Prototypes also enable the team to assess usability and functionality early on. By the end of this phase, the team establishes a solid foundation for the development phase.

Testing and Deployment

Testing and deployment ensure the custom retail software meets quality standards. Developers conduct various tests, including unit, integration, and user acceptance testing. Gathering feedback during this stage identifies issues that require resolution. The deployment phase includes transitioning the software into the live environment. A well-planned rollout minimizes disruptions while ensuring users receive adequate training. Continuous monitoring after deployment helps address any post-launch issues swiftly. These steps collectively enhance the software’s performance and user satisfaction.

Challenges in Custom Retail Software Development

Custom retail software development presents several challenges that businesses must navigate for effective implementation.

Cost Considerations

Investment costs often emerge as a primary concern for retailers. While custom solutions typically entail higher upfront expenses compared to off-the-shelf options, long-term financial benefits can outweigh initial outlays. Efficient operational processes reduce costs, contributing to overall savings over time. Retailers can achieve this through enhanced functionality, resulting in lower support and maintenance needs. Moreover, improved inventory management and customer engagement strategies lead to increased sales, justifying the investment in custom software.

Integration with Existing Systems

Integrating custom software with existing systems can pose significant challenges. Many retailers rely on a mix of legacy and modern solutions, creating potential compatibility issues. Successful integration requires a detailed analysis of current technology stacks and workflows. Harmonizing custom software with existing systems ensures a seamless transition and uninterrupted operations. Retailers benefit from expert guidance during this process, allowing for better alignment between new and old systems. Ultimately, proper integration minimizes disruptions and leverages previous investments in technology.

Custom retail software development stands as a vital strategy for retailers aiming to thrive in a competitive landscape. By embracing tailored solutions, businesses can enhance operational efficiency and deliver exceptional customer experiences. This approach not only addresses unique challenges but also fosters adaptability in an ever-evolving market.

Investing in custom software may require a higher initial cost, but the long-term benefits, including improved functionality and reduced downtime, are undeniable. Retailers can achieve better inventory management and customer engagement through personalized solutions that align with their brand strategies. Ultimately, custom retail software empowers businesses to make data-driven decisions that drive growth and strengthen customer loyalty.